> I cannot boot anymore, as I get the following message of kernel panic:
>
> «Enforcing mode requested but no policy loaded. Halting now.
>
> Kernel panic - not syncing: Attempted to kill init!»
>
> This occurred after uninstalling+installing kernel. Any ideas?
You could just disable selinux at boot time with the selinux=0 kernel parameter.
